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Stroud (Gloucs) to St Ives (Cornwall) start from as little as £14.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Stroud (Gloucs) to St Ives (Cornwall) start from £72.20 one way, or £112.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Stroud (Gloucs) to St Ives (Cornwall) are available for £133.20 one way, or £136.70 return

Everything you need to know about Stroud (Gloucs) Station

Discovering Stroud (Gloucs) Train Station

Nestled in the scenic Cotswolds, Stroud (Gloucs) train station serves as a key hub for both locals and visitors to the picturesque town of Stroud. This station is not just a gateway to lush landscapes and quaint villages, but also a portal connecting travelers to various major cities and destinations across the UK. Whether you're on a journey to explore the artistic charm of Stroud or using the station as a stop along your route, there is plenty to discover and enjoy.

Operated by Great Western Railway, Stroud (Gloucs) station offers a range of facilities and amenities designed to ensure a smooth and convenient travel experience. Travelers can purchase tickets during considerable opening hours, from 06:30 to 18:00 on weekdays and a slightly shorter timeframe on Saturdays. There's no ticket office service on Sundays, but fret not as ticket machines are available any time you need them. For those tech-savvy passengers with smartcards, the station is equipped with both smartcard issuance and validation capabilities.

Facilities and Accessibility

The station offers a variety of facilities to enhance passenger experience. Including accessible ticket machines and an induction loop, the station ensures that all passengers, including those with additional needs, can travel with confidence. However, it's important to note that while there are step-free access parts, moving between the ticket office and certain platforms may involve a longer route or require assistance due to gradients and a stepbridge present at the site.

For your comfort while you wait, there are seating areas along with designated waiting rooms located in the ticket hall—available most of the day across the week. You might also need to note the absence of accessible toilets, but standard toilets operated by RADAR keys are positioned on Platform 1.

Onward Travel Options

Stroud station is well connected with other modes of transportation, offering diverse options for onward travel. The station's convenient links include a local bus service accessible directly from the station premises. Detailed information on planning your journey by bus can be found in handy printable formats online.

If ever required, the station's Platform 2 side is utilized for rail replacement services, ensuring your journey does not come to a halt even in the rare case of disruptions. Although taxis and car hires might not have direct facilities at the station, the town of Stroud provides ample options for those needing a ride further afield.

Everything you need to know about St Ives (Cornwall) Station

Discovering St Ives (Cornwall) Train Station

St Ives is a stunning coastal town located in Cornwall, renowned for its beautiful sandy beaches, charming local shops, and vibrant cultural scene. A visit to this idyllic location often begins at the St Ives (Cornwall) train station, which serves as a gateway to this picturesque area. Whether you're arriving to soak up the sun, explore the artistic charm, or simply unwind, this station connects you seamlessly to your destinations.

Facilities at St Ives (Cornwall) Train Station

When you first arrive at St Ives train station, you'll find ticket buying a breeze with the available ticket office open from 8:00 AM to 6:00 PM daily. For travelers wanting to pre-plan, tickets can easily be collected from the ticket machines, which are also accessible for those with disabilities. Plus, there's a handy induction loop for additional support.

The station boasts step-free access throughout, ensuring ease of movement for everyone, with ramps available for boarding trains. Although it lacks amenities like refreshment facilities, an ATM, and waiting rooms, there is a seating area where passengers can rest comfortably while waiting for their train.

Connectivity and Travel Options

Speaking of connectivity, onward travel from St Ives is well-catered with transport links. There's a bus stop at Malakoff and Triton Terrace, providing a rail replacement service if needed. For those who prefer planning ahead, further information about buses and other transport connections can be downloaded from the National Rail website.
